While America's most important river may depend on the region in which you live, traditionally the most important river has been the Mississippi. It is the largest river in North America, running 2,430 miles from Lake Itasca in Minnesota down to the Gulf of Mexico. It is the largest drainage system in North America and it's drainage basin drains parts of 31 American states and 2 Canadian provinces.
